Zusammenfassung:A rapid scanning autocorrelation interferometer for measurements of ultrafast laser pulses is described. The optical system is based on a new type of beam splitter allowing one to send all of the input beam power to the SHG crystal making the SHG signal four times greater than in the standard designs. Autocorrelation measurements of transform limited picosecond pulses from a synchronously pumped mode‐locked dye laser are presented.
